Leading a diverse team as a non-profit program manager presents unique challenges and opportunities. Diversity can bring a wealth of perspectives and skills to your organization, but it also requires a thoughtful approach to leadership. Effective management of a diverse team involves understanding and valuing individual differences, fostering an inclusive environment, and leveraging the strengths of team members for the success of your programs. By embracing diversity, you can enhance creativity, problem-solving, and program outcomes, ultimately contributing to the greater good your non-profit is striving to achieve.
